GBP/USD spins in a giant circle on Monday

GBP/USD roiled on Monday, tumbling 1.5% during the overnight session before recovering back to flat for the day at the 1.2400 handle. Import tariffs from the US brewing into a large-scale global trade war hobbled market sentiment over the weekend. Read More...

GBP/USD falls below 1.2300 following Trump tariffs

GBP/USD continues its decline for the fifth consecutive session, hovering around 1.2270 during Monday’s Asian trading hours. The pair has weakened by around 1% as the US Dollar Index (DXY), which measures the US Dollar (USD) against six major peers, gains strength following US President Donald Trump’s tariffs against China, Canada, and Mexico.
